Job Description

Job Title: CNC Tool Grinder/Programmer

Department: Grinding

Reports to: Production Unit Manager

Classification: Non-Exempt

Location: Nashville, TN

Travel: None

Job Summary: The CNC Tool Grinder/Programmer to produce premium quality, high precision,

carbide cutting tools using specific tool grinding machines and programs. Will ensure proper set up machines, programming, tooling, and parts are machined in accordance with manufacturing standards and specifications.

Supervisory Responsibilities:

  • None

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Program, setup and operate machines to produce tools per product specifications.

  • Ensure product accuracy and uniformity throughout the manufacturing process creating consistent parts.

  • Read technical drawings/blueprints to develop custom programs for specialty tooling.

  • Provide general preventative maintenance to all machines.

  • Identify wheel wear on ALL wheel types

  • Create master programs for all standard and modified standard endmills.

  • Set-up, inspect, produce good first piece & run production on drills, keyway cutters, dovetail cutters & reamers.

  • Create programs and wheel offsets to drills, keyway cutters, dovetail cutters & reamers.

  • Create master programs for ANY cutting tool within software capabilities.

  • Other duties as assigned.

Education and Experience:

  • High school diploma or equivalent; technical or vocational training in machining, programming or related field is preferred.

  • 5+ years of experience in CNC tool and grinder programming.

  • Must be proficient in using Numroto, Rollomatic VGPro, Walter Tool Studio and/or Anca ToolRoom software (multiple disciples preferred).

  • Strong knowledge of CNC machining processes and programming languages.

  • Ability to read and interpret technical drawings and specifications.

  •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.

  • Excellent communication and teamwork skills.

Required Skills/Abilities:

  • Requires hands-on experience with G-code programming to support CNC machine setup, troubleshooting, and production efficiency

Physical Requirements:

  • Prolonged periods of standing with some lifting, bending, and twisting.

  • Ability to lift up to 50 pounds.

  • Ability to stoop, bend or kneel when required.
